Acromyrmex fracticornis

Wikipedia Abstract

Acromyrmex fracticornis is a species of leaf-cutter ant, a New World ant of the subfamily Myrmicinae of the genus Acromyrmex. This species is from one of the two genera of advanced attines (fungus-growing ants) within the tribe Attini. It is found in the wild naturally in southern Brazil, Paraguay and northern Argentina.
